Output 43ed05e58cb13176dab93ecc0f880c01a8fdeee938ab15348f02fe831aa61d63:4

value
2434000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4188a9ffac78e92b4c3c376eaa8b0f84a52c1853 OP_EQUAL
address
37fXZbdeLKzFjnJGsa6uus1U2RD9Eq5wJW
transaction
43ed05e58cb13176dab93ecc0f880c01a8fdeee938ab15348f02fe831aa61d63
spent
true